echarts是一個非常流行的可視化工具,可以用它來制作各種圖表并展示數據。而在使用echarts時,我們通常需要使用JSON來描述數據,其中就包括了地圖數據的描述。
如果要展示地圖數據,需要用到echarts的map組件。而對于我們自己的省市縣數據,需要使用JSON進行描述,這就需要有對應的JSON數據文件。在本文中,我們將介紹使用echarts中的map組件,展示區縣的JSON數據文件。
// 區縣的JSON數據格式如下所示: { "type": "FeatureCollection", "features": [ { "type": "Feature", "id": "110101", "properties": { "name": "東城區", "cp": [ 116.418757, 39.917544 ], "childNum": 1 }, "geometry": { "type": "MultiPolygon", "coordinates": [ [ [ [116.413131, 39.895691], [116.411886, 39.895045], [116.411066, 39.894033], [116.410864, 39.893151], [116.411225, 39.891908], ... ] ] ] } }, ... ] }
從代碼中可以看出,每一個feature對應一個區縣,其中包含了name、cp、childNum等屬性信息,而geometry則是該區縣所占的范圍。在實際使用中,我們可以根據這些信息,在echarts中展示相應的地圖。
具體的代碼實現請參考echarts的官方文檔。同樣需要注意的是,在使用時要匹配所使用的echarts版本與JSON數據格式,才能正確的顯示圖表。